Description

This is a 4 bed children's residential home, offering 52 week care in a warm, homely environment. It is situated in an established residential area. The home prides itself on care and support for children with learning and physical disabilities and associated behaviours. The home prides itself on working with families and professionals, to provide opportunities for learning, increasing independence and more importantly FUN.

You will be working Early shifts, late shifts, long days and the rota does include alternate weekends. You will assist the management team in maintaining a safe and enabling environment that provides positive experiences to children and young people.

Qualifications / Experience

Successful candidates will need to have or be willing to work towards:

  • Level 3/4 Diploma for Residential Childcare or Level 3 Diploma for the Children and Young People’s Workforce (Social Care Pathway)
  • Ideally you will also have experience of working with children and young people with moderate to severe learning disabilities and/or physical disabilities, Autism, ADHD, sensory impairment, and associated behavioural challenges and/or complex care needs, however we will consider candidates from EBD residential settings also.
